You asked
Please send me:
Information request - 1
Copies of all 'as is' and 'to be' role profiles as used to inform the decisions made by the matching panels that convened between July and August 2019 as part of the ONS Economic Statistics Group's 'Transformation' programme.
Information request - 2
Copies of electronic communications issued by the ESG TOM team, HR Business Partners and ESG senior management to ESG staff in relation to the 'to be' role profiles. As well as the 3 month period prior to the 'as is' role profile baseline being finalised and a month after the ESG 'Transformation' matching exercise.
Information request - 3
Details of all verbal communications by the ESG TOM team, HR Business Partners and ESG senior management to ESG staff in relation to 'as is' and 'to be' role profiles during ESG 'Transformation' prior to the above matching exercises.
Information request - 4
Details of role profile specific events that took place in ESG to allow staff to better understand the process and ensure relevant role profiles were up-to-date and accurate prior to the above matching exercises. Also, details of who attended any such events.
Information request – 5
Details of all ESG TOM matching panels' meeting notes, records and communications (paper and electronic).
Information request – 6
Details of the dates ESG TOM 'as is' profiles for areas were set/assigned and the dates that those profiles were last amended
Information request – 7
Details of who signed off each 'as is' role profile.
Information request – 8
Details (names) of the composition of ESG TOM matching panels and the names of the "subject matter experts" (and rationale for that title).
We said
Thank you for your request.
Please find as follows a comprehensive description of the individual requests to accompany the documents provided in the associated downloads.
Information request - 1
'As Is' and 'To Be' role profiles used in the 2018 and 2019 ESG TOM consultations have been provided as requested.
Information request - 2
All ESG communications issued by ESG TOM team, HR Business Partners and ESG senior management to all ESG staff have been included in the information provided.
In order to provide a clear and broad view of the engagement on this topic ESG have provided documents covering the period of January 2018 to July 2018 when "Response to the consultation on ESG's Target Operating Model" was published.
Please note, information provided in response to information request 4 covers July 2018 to September 2019
Information request - 3
We do not hold records of verbal communications.
Information request - 4
Details of ESG TOM 'All staff' events related to transformation have been provided. Included are a wide arrange of event types such as, calendar meetings, dates of staff sessions, Skype Q&A 'drop in' events, role profile specific events, fishbowl events, grade community sessions and Eventbrite information covering event dates and numbers of booked attendees.
We have additionally provided communications disseminated at the workshops and staff events, from December 2018 through to September 2019 as role profile specific questions may have been covered during these open-door events.
Information request - 5
Details of the ESG TOM matching panels' meeting notes, outcomes records and communications (paper and electronic) have been provided.
Information request - 6
The 'As Is' role profiles were stabilised when ESG published the "Response to the consultation on ESG's Target Operating Model" on 10th July 2018. This means the information request sits within a timeframe spanning 10th April 2018 to 10th August 2018.
It should be noted that whilst the "As Is" profiles were stabilised at that point, very minor amendments may have taken place during the period between responding to the 2018 consultation and responding to the 2019 consultation. These would have been actioned where vacancies arose in response to evolving business needs, with the intention of achieving further alignment with ESG's organisation with its future organisational design, as captured in the Organisational Change Action Plans.
Information request - 7
The 'As Is' profiles were agreed by the ESG Senior Leadership cohort at the time of publication of "Response to the consultation on ESG's Target Operating Model" on 10th July 2018
Information request - 8
Details including names of the ESG TOM matching panels and the names of the "subject matter experts" have been provided. Subject matter experts were utilised where detailed technical knowledge of role profiles was required by the panel members.
Some of the information has been withheld from the documents as it is considered personal data that is exempt from disclosure under s.40(2) of the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) 2000.
